Output f3c2d6b9077d23e88ada70b4f3d495af20966d9f554a07f78fd5b3b27eac7811:61

value
1403327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b23f984906bfcd829ac96dc6536b814980f7db OP_EQUAL
address
38bG8r9bsUSUoihVE4GNdhmVKyP7eZmJKB
transaction
f3c2d6b9077d23e88ada70b4f3d495af20966d9f554a07f78fd5b3b27eac7811
confirmations
213708
spent
true